Pendeford Mill Nature Reserve
The reserve is a valuable environmental and historical resource dating back to the 13th Century. It provides a balanced and protected habitat for wildlife on the fringe of an urban area.
Visit the Nature Reserve
Due to the extremely sensitive environmental nature of the reserve, all visits must be booked in advance.
A small classroom and toilets are available, guided walks and educational visits can be arranged with the resident staff. Occasionally, Open Weekends are held, details of which are published separately.
